Saints Camp, Aug. 14 (afternoon): Thomas speaks, and Reggie, too.

The Saints went through about a 55-minute walk through in jerseys and shorts, no helmets Thursday afternoon. After three physical practices against the Houston Texans the past two days, head coach Sean Payton likely wanted his team to begin recuperating in time for Saturday night's game.

Hollis Thomas showed up, hours after having surgery to repair a torn right triceps. And Reggie Bush, who didn't practice in the morning, talked about about his knee.

Thomas said the injury happened when he was trying to "disengage" from a pass rush against Texans center Chris Myers, a fourth-year pro out of Miami.

"Just one of those freak things that happened," Thomas said. "I went to throw somebody and they grabbed the back of my arm and I heard a tear."

Thomas said he originally thought it was a strain. "The MRI was a precautionary thing," Thomas said. "When they went in for the MRI, they saw it."

As for Bush, the running back has been nursing a swollen left knee, something unrelated to his PCL tear late last season.

But don't fear, he said. He's sitting only as a precautionary measure.

"I actually got an MRI," Bush said. "Everything came back positive, looks good. It was great."

The MRI came two days ago and showed no tears or strains, Bush said.
